Lake June, Arkansas Fishing

Location and Information: Lake June is located in Lafayette County, Arkansas. This body of water covers approximately 60 acres of surface area. You will find boating, kayaking and fishing here.

Lake address: 429 Magnolia Street, Stamps, Arkansas 71860

There are numerous different species of fish to find on this body of water. So, what type of fish are in this lake? You can find Carp, Sunfish, Channel Catfish and Largemouth Bass on these waters.

Special Regulations on this lake are

  • The Catfish daily limit is five.
  • Largemouth bass, crappie and bream are to be released immediately.
  • Lake bed closed to entrance during renovation.
  • Open to fishing with rod or pole only.
  • Handicapped-accessible fishing pier is available.

Top Species and Creel Limits for Arkansas

  • Largemouth Bass: 10 daily combined total with other bass
  • Smallmouth Bass: 10 daily combined total with other bass
  • Black Bass: 10 daily combined total with other bass
  • Bream: 50 a day combined
  • Catfish: 10 daily combined with other catfish./ No limit on bullhead
  • Pickerel: 6 a day
  • Sauger: 6 a day
  • Saugeye: 6 a day
  • Walleye: 6 a day
  • White Bass: 25 a day
  • Yellow Bass: No limit
  • Crappie: 30 a day combined black and white
